Accreditation is a process through which an independent organization evaluates and verifies that a service provider meets certain standards of quality, safety, and professionalism. This process typically involves a comprehensive review of the provider’s operations, policies, and practices to ensure that they adhere to the industry’s best practices. Once accreditation is granted, the service provider is recognized as being in compliance with these standards, giving consumers peace of mind that they are receiving high-quality services.

Accreditation is also important in the education sector. Schools, colleges, and universities that are accredited have been evaluated to ensure that they meet certain academic standards and provide a quality education to students. This includes factors such as the qualifications of the faculty, the curriculum, and the resources available to students. Employers and other educational institutions often look for accreditation when evaluating the credentials of a potential hire or transfer student, as it serves as a reliable indicator of the quality of education received.
